Tugas 5: Percabangan Switch
using System;
class Program
{
static void Main(string[] args)
{
Console.WriteLine("Kalkulator Sederhana");
Console.Write("Masukkan angka pertama: ");
double angka1 = double.Parse(Console.ReadLine());
Console.Write("Masukkan operator (+, -, *, /): ");
char op = char.Parse(Console.ReadLine());
Console.Write("Masukkan angka kedua: ");
double angka2 = double.Parse(Console.ReadLine());
double hasil = 0.0;
switch (op)
{
case '+':
hasil = angka1 + angka2;
break;
case '-':
hasil = angka1 - angka2;
break;
case '*':
hasil = angka1 * angka2;
break;
case '/':
if (angka2 != 0)
hasil = angka1 / angka2;
else
Console.WriteLine("Tidak bisa dibagi dengan nol.");
break;
default:
Console.WriteLine("Operator tidak valid.");
break;
}
Console.WriteLine($"Hasil: {hasil}");
}
}
Komentar
Posting Komentar